UIL names 211 students to 2026 All-State Journalism Staff
Students who earn more than 50 points through competition at the local, regional, state and national levels earn acceptance to the All-State Journalism Staff. For 2026, UIL recognizes 211 students for overall excellence in scholastic journalism from UIL competition to yearbook, newspaper, online news and broadcast journalism competitions. UIL A+ Academics Update for 2026-27
The UIL A+ Academics Meet designations and timeframes are changing beginning the 2026-2027 school year to allow for more flexibility. The previously used invitational and district meet designations to refer to the materials will be referred to as Set A, Set B, and Set C. Please see this documentfor more information.

2026-28 Music Alignments Announced
UIL has released the 2026-28 music alignments, to include area assignments. Geographically contiguous music regions are assigned to areas by the UIL, while also considering the projected number of competing schools based on recent region contest ratings.
